永洪社区

标题: 计算列 [打印本页]

作者: yhdata_mJweRwQy    时间: 2023-7-11 14:25
标题: 计算列
想写一下”天数>365“为”一年以上“,”天数>7“为7天至一年,其余的为”7天以内“,这种的计算列应该怎么写呢,试过用if,不太行
作者: yhdata_ruby    时间: 2023-7-11 14:38
你的数据是什么样的,计算列你是怎么写的呢
作者: 宋宋    时间: 2023-7-11 14:53
天数你的数据是度量值吧?if col['天数']>365 then "一年以上" elseif col['天数']>7 then "为7天至一年" else "7天以内"

作者: yhdata_h3WExqsQ    时间: 2023-7-11 14:54
if可以的吧,会不会是你写错了,你的计算列怎么写的啊?
作者: yhdata_mJweRwQy    时间: 2023-7-11 15:08
宋宋 发表于 2023-7-11 14:53
天数你的数据是度量值吧?if col['天数']>365 then "一年以上" elseif col['天数']>7 then "为7天至一年" e ...

好的,谢谢您

作者: yhdata_mJweRwQy    时间: 2023-7-11 15:09
宋宋 发表于 2023-7-11 14:53
天数你的数据是度量值吧?if col['天数']>365 then "一年以上" elseif col['天数']>7 then "为7天至一年" e ...

这个需要加括号什么的吗?

作者: yhdata_mJweRwQy    时间: 2023-7-11 15:12
yhdata_ruby 发表于 2023-7-11 14:38
你的数据是什么样的,计算列你是怎么写的呢

我是这样写的,它提示我{}这个符号错误

作者: yhdata_ruby    时间: 2023-7-11 15:19
yhdata_mJweRwQy 发表于 2023-7-11 15:12
我是这样写的,它提示我{}这个符号错误

用if  then 这样的去写哈,参考https://www.yonghongtech.com/rea ... oom_highlightsub=if
作者: yhdata_mJweRwQy    时间: 2023-7-11 15:55
yhdata_ruby 发表于 2023-7-11 15:19
用if  then 这样的去写哈,参考https://www.yonghongtech.com/real-help/Z-Suite/10.0/ch/logicalfunctio ...

那符号会限制吗?





欢迎光临 永洪社区 (http://club.yonghongtech.com/) Powered by Discuz! X3.4